Jason Hayden
Jason Hayden currently holds the self-made position of Internet Brand and Domain Name Manager for Greenberg Traurig, LLP (www.gtlaw.com) in Las Vegas, Nevada. His primary focus is bridging the gap between common knowledge and complex technology/Internet issues so that clients can make the most informed decisions. Client support includes recovery of domain names through dispute actions, secondary market domain name purchases, complex technology litigation support, and planning defensive gTLD and ccTLD portfolio registrations to support Trademark and Business Unit presence on the Internet and in local retail markets.
Jason earned his B.S. in Business Administration and Marketing from the University of Nevada, Las Vegas. Prior to joining Greenberg Traurig, Jason managed the Information Technology department, Domain Name Management department, and Facilities Management department for the law firm Quirk & Tratos.
